Stacked Launches Self-Custodial Lightning Wallet as New Zealand's Last Major Non-Custodial Bitcoin Exchange

Introduction to Stacked's Self-Custodial Wallet

Stacked's self-custodial wallet allows users to send fiat and receive Bitcoin into their self-custodied wallet of choice. The company has taken a different path than larger exchanges in the country, which are going all-in on selling custodial and paper bitcoin.

Key Features of the Stacked Wallet

Lightning Network Integration

The Stacked wallet features a sleek and modern design, using Breez and Spark SDKs in the back end to provide users a stable and easy-to-use Bitcoin experience, with full Lightning Network integration.

Autostack and Contact Management

The app lets users purchase Bitcoin manually and on a schedule via Autostack, a DCA style set it and forget it purchase feature. Users can also manage contacts in the app to pay with bitcoin on their end and deliver fiat to recipients.

Regulatory Environment and Market Projections

New Zealand has no capital gains tax, instead, Bitcoin profits are taxed as income, resulting in a favorable regulatory environment for hyper Bitcoinization. Stacked projects the local digital asset market will generate revenue exceeding US$200 million in 2026.
